Meaning, pronunciation, translations and examples WebThe humblebrag is one of my favourite modern portmanteaus. It was coined in 2010 by writer Harris Wittels, from the show Parks and Rec, before he died (of a drug overdose) in 2015. The aptly-coined term refers to … events in louisville this month
